// Return the id of the button pressed.
static UInt16 display_modal_form(FormPtr form) {
  FormPtr prev_form = FrmGetActiveForm();
  UInt16 button_id;

  FrmSetActiveForm(form);
  
  // We do not need an eventhandler
  button_id = FrmDoDialog(form);
  
  // We do not read any values from the form.
  if (prev_form)
    FrmSetActiveForm(prev_form);
  FrmDeleteForm(form);
  
  return button_id;
}

/***********************************************************************
 *
 * FUNCTION:    SelectOneTime
 *
 * DESCRIPTION: Display a form showing a time and allow the user
 *              to select a different time. This is the single time
 *					 dialog as seen in general panel
 *
 * PARAMETERS:  hour	- pointer to hour to change
 					 minute - pointer to minute to change
 *				title	- string title for the dialog
 *
 * RETURNED:	 true if the OK button was pressed
 *					 if true the parameters passed are changed
 *
 * REVISION HISTORY:
 *			Name	Date		Description
 *			----	----		-----------
 *			roger	12/2/94		Initial Revision in General Panel
 *			gavin	3/20/98		Extracted into separate system function
 *
 ***********************************************************************/
Boolean SelectOneTime(Int16 *hour,Int16 *minute, const Char * titleP)
{
	FormType * originalForm, * frm;
	EventType event;
	Boolean confirmed = false;
	Boolean handled = false;
	Boolean done = false;
	TimeFormatType timeFormat;			// Format to display time in
	Int16   curHour;
	UInt16	currentTimeButton;
	UInt8	hoursTimeButtonValue;
	Char	hoursTimeButtonString[3];
	UInt8	minuteTensButtonValue;
	Char	minuteTensButtonString[2];
	UInt8	minuteOnesButtonValue;
	Char	minuteOnesButtonString[2];
	Char	separatorString[3];

	timeFormat = (TimeFormatType)PrefGetPreference(prefTimeFormat);

	originalForm = FrmGetActiveForm();
	frm = (FormType *) FrmInitForm (SelectOneTimeDialog); 
	if (titleP)
		FrmSetTitle (frm, (Char *) titleP);

	FrmSetActiveForm (frm);
	
	curHour = *hour;
	
	if (Use24HourFormat(timeFormat))
		{
		// Hide the AM & PM ui
		FrmHideObject (frm, FrmGetObjectIndex (frm, timeAMCheckbox));
		FrmHideObject (frm, FrmGetObjectIndex (frm, timePMCheckbox));
		}
	else 
		{
		if (curHour < 12)
			CtlSetValue(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, timeAMCheckbox)), true);
		else
			{
			CtlSetValue(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, timePMCheckbox)), true);
			curHour -= 12;
			}
		
		if (curHour == 0)
			curHour = 12;
		}

	// Set the time seperator to the system defined one
	separatorString[0] = TimeSeparator(timeFormat);
	separatorString[1] = '\0';
	FrmCopyLabel(frm, timeSeparatorLabel, separatorString);


	// Now set the time displayed in the push buttons.
	hoursTimeButtonValue = curHour;
	StrIToA(hoursTimeButtonString, hoursTimeButtonValue);
	CtlSetLabel(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, timeHourButton)),
		hoursTimeButtonString);
		
	minuteTensButtonValue = *minute / 10;
	StrIToA(minuteTensButtonString, minuteTensButtonValue);
	CtlSetLabel(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, timeMinutesTensButton)),
		minuteTensButtonString);
		
	minuteOnesButtonValue = *minute % 10;
	StrIToA(minuteOnesButtonString, minuteOnesButtonValue);
	CtlSetLabel(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, timeMinutesOnesButton)),
		minuteOnesButtonString);


	// Set the hour time button to be the one set by the arrows
	currentTimeButton = defaultTimeButton;
	CtlSetValue(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, defaultTimeButton)), true);

	
	FrmDrawForm (frm);

	
	while (!done)
		{
		EvtGetEvent (&event, evtWaitForever);

		if (! SysHandleEvent ((EventType *)&event))	
			FrmHandleEvent (frm,&event); 

		if (event.eType == ctlSelectEvent)
			{
			switch (event.data.ctlSelect.controlID)
				{
				case timeOkButton:
					frm = FrmGetActiveForm();

					// Set the new time (seconds are cleared).
					if (Use24HourFormat(timeFormat))
						*hour = hoursTimeButtonValue;
					else
						{
						*hour = hoursTimeButtonValue % 12 + // 12am is 0 hours!
							(CtlGetValue(FrmGetObjectPtr (frm,
																	FrmGetObjectIndex (frm,
																					timePMCheckbox)))
							? 12 : 0);
						}

					*minute = minuteTensButtonValue * 10 + minuteOnesButtonValue;

					done = true;
					confirmed = true;
					break;

				case timeCancelButton:
					done = true;
					break;
					
				case timeDecreaseButton:
				case timeIncreaseButton:
					frm = FrmGetActiveForm();
					switch (currentTimeButton)
						{
						// MemHandle increasing and decreasing the time for each time digit
						case timeHourButton:
							if (event.data.ctlSelect.controlID == timeDecreaseButton)
								{
								if (Use24HourFormat(timeFormat))
									if (hoursTimeButtonValue > 0)
										hoursTimeButtonValue--;
									else
										hoursTimeButtonValue = 23;
								else
									if (hoursTimeButtonValue > 1)
										hoursTimeButtonValue--;
									else
										hoursTimeButtonValue = 12;
								}
							else
								{
								if (Use24HourFormat(timeFormat))
									if (hoursTimeButtonValue < 23)
										hoursTimeButtonValue++;
									else
										hoursTimeButtonValue = 0;
								else
									if (hoursTimeButtonValue < 12)
										hoursTimeButtonValue++;
									else
										hoursTimeButtonValue = 1;
								}
								
							StrIToA(hoursTimeButtonString, hoursTimeButtonValue);
							CtlSetLabel(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, 
								timeHourButton)),	hoursTimeButtonString);
							break;

						case timeMinutesTensButton:
							if (event.data.ctlSelect.controlID == timeDecreaseButton)
								{
								if (minuteTensButtonValue > 0)
									minuteTensButtonValue--;
								else
									minuteTensButtonValue = 5;
								}
							else
								{
								if (minuteTensButtonValue < 5)
									minuteTensButtonValue++;
								else
									minuteTensButtonValue = 0;
								}

							StrIToA(minuteTensButtonString, minuteTensButtonValue);
							CtlSetLabel(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, 
								timeMinutesTensButton)), minuteTensButtonString);
							break;
							
						case timeMinutesOnesButton:
							if (event.data.ctlSelect.controlID == timeDecreaseButton)
								{
								if (minuteOnesButtonValue > 0)
									minuteOnesButtonValue--;
								else
									minuteOnesButtonValue = 9;
								}
							else
								{
								if (minuteOnesButtonValue < 9)
									minuteOnesButtonValue++;
								else
									minuteOnesButtonValue = 0;
								}

							StrIToA(minuteOnesButtonString, minuteOnesButtonValue);
							CtlSetLabel(FrmGetObjectPtr (frm, FrmGetObjectIndex (frm, 
								timeMinutesOnesButton)), minuteOnesButtonString);
							break;
						}

					handled = true;
					break;	// timeDecreaseButton & timeIncreaseButton
		
				case timeHourButton:
					currentTimeButton = timeHourButton;
					break;
					
				case timeMinutesTensButton:
					currentTimeButton = timeMinutesTensButton;
					break;
					
				case timeMinutesOnesButton:
					currentTimeButton = timeMinutesOnesButton;
					break;
					
				}
			}

		else if (event.eType == appStopEvent)
			{
			EvtAddEventToQueue (&event);
			done = true;
			break;
			}
			
		}	// end while true
		
	FrmEraseForm (frm);
	FrmDeleteForm (frm);
	
	FrmSetActiveForm(originalForm);
	
	return (confirmed);
}
